Protecting your shells
 
im just about to send a shell away to be painted and with this investment clearly I dont want to be losing paint.

so how do you guys protect the paint? or how do you? what do you use?

thanks.

hammerhead 01-01-2011 10:39 PM

i use a pva substance give it a couple of coats its nice and thick and stops any rubbing of the body shell

jonmiller 01-01-2011 10:43 PM

you shouldn't have to worry about that, your painter should seal the shell/s for you.

personally, i use plastikote super clear.

DCM 01-01-2011 10:50 PM

On some shells I will plastikote, and if wings are being painted, I will do the same, but to be fair, as long as the water based paint has time to cure, paint should be sound, I have shells here that are 2 1/2 years old, used regular by the kids, and paint still in tact.
